Output e83bcd5931fa3051412b5dff8f209ef899a639032629d422bd4a81267b495572:1

value
1020976
script pubkey
OP_HASH160 OP_PUSHBYTES_20 087a537121a4123fae4a91cf3ae9e1a81e9bd0e9 OP_EQUAL
address
32TqsS8Rr9NFLhZX1N2bYC4XHw4GkoCeCX
transaction
e83bcd5931fa3051412b5dff8f209ef899a639032629d422bd4a81267b495572
spent
true